
EVALUATION OF MEDICAL DEVICES FOR BIOLOGICAL HAZARDS - METHOD OF TEST FOR SKIN IRRITATION OF EXTRACTS FROM MEDICAL DEVICES

Details tests to assess the irritation of skin by leachable endogenous or extraneous substances in or on a medical device. Defines the use of both polar and non-polar solvents to obtain extracts of devices. Recommended for the initial assessment of devices designed for short-term use within the body or in contact with mucosal surfaces, tracheal tubes, urinary catheters, intravenous cannulae, used in contact with the skin, splints, and those used to contain or administer substances, eyedrop containers. Advises results be assessed by a toxicologist.
